Role and responsibility synopsis

As part of the ROO Completions and Handover Group and reporting to the ROO Completions & Handover Team Lead, the following key roles and responsibilities should be fulfilled by the GOC Completions Engineer (Mechanical.) The main functions will be documentation reviews, data verifications and data uploads, vendor site visits and assistance with Inspection activities.

·         Complete familiarity and experience in the use of a Completions System. Go Completions GoC preferred.

·         Strong Communication skills to present the GO Completions (GOC) System and Process to Contractors/Vendors and hold Completions and Handover      Progress meetings with Contractors.

·         Have a full understanding of Engineering drawings for all disciplines.

·         Ability and experience to manage across all disciplines and diverse cultures.

·         Has previously held a lead role in Completions and Handovers.

·         Manage and support Discipline Inspectors on the Completions Process and ITR completion.

·         Management and co-ordination of GOC construction and inspection activities.

·         Fully conversant with the theory and implementation of Limits of System Handover (LOSH).

·         Strong experience with welding and flange management procedures.

·         Welding qualification is essential.

·         Familiar with International Codes and Standards.

·         Good understanding of process isolation procedures and piping drawings.

·         Good understanding of piping, mechanical, structural and civil engineering standards.

·         Comfortable with confined space entry for Vessel inspections.

·         Commissioning and Operation experience is desirable.

·         A Safety Leader
